> On Thu, Aug 26, 2010 at 12:42 PM, Dianne Hackborn <hack...@android.com>wrote: > >> - See if having them clear data first before trying to uninstall solves >> the problem. >> > > I'll have someone try this next time I get an email and report back. > OK, so had two more emails yesterday and told them to clear their data by going through the manage applications screen. I made no mention of uninstalling and re-installing. One got back to me last night and confirmed that this worked for her. I did not hear back from the other, which I assume means she's happy and it worked for her as well. So, apparently a complete uninstall is not necessary - there's something wrong in the data. So now the question is what's going wrong in the app data that would cause the app code to return null pointers on stuff that's not relying on app data?
